HI! I’M NICOLA WARBURTON AND I AM THE OWNER AND FOUNDER OF CLEANERSCENE.
I was born in Crewe in 1977 and completed my secondary education at St Thomas More RC High School. I then studied for four years at South Cheshire College. There I completed a BTEC National and a HND in Travel and Tourism Management.
At the end of my studies, I was unsure as to what I wanted to do. The jobs within the travel sector where I had hoped to have worked didn’t want to recruit college leavers. At the time, they preferred to recruit on a YTS scheme. As a result I found myself working in various environments gaining experience in many areas. These included administration, accounts, reception, customer service, telesales, supervisory management and my last employed job in field sales.

IN 2005 I STARTED LOOKING FOR A CLEANER MYSELF.
I was working full time and spending much of my precious free time completing the household chores.
What I discovered was that there was a lack of local companies in the Crewe and Nantwich area. I didn’t know anybody who might want to come and clean for me. I also needed to know that the people coming into my home were going to be trustworthy, honest and reliable. Letting a stranger into my home when I wasn’t going to be there was a big decision.
I thought a company would be the way forward. However, when I started to do some research, I discovered that there didn’t seem to be any professional, local companies. There were franchises but to me they felt impersonal and above all, too expensive for me.

THE BIRTH OF CLEANERSCENE!
I thought about it long and hard. After some market research and lots of planning, I took the plunge and quit my day job as a sales representative. After that I launched my company, Cleanerscene.
For five years, I built up the business working from home. In addition, I built a team of 6 staff and I worked alongside them daily. We cleaned many houses, offices, narrow boats, holiday lets, end of tenancy properties for landlords and tenants. There isn’t much I haven’t seen or cleaned personally.
In 2011, I stood on Welsh Row in Nantwich one day and noticed that there was a shop to let. I thought it would be a good location for an office for my business. Again I took a chance as an office wasn’t really necessary. I knew it would make me stand out as a professional business. This was a good move and really put Cleanerscene on the map. We have traded from there since that time.
